怎么查询mysql的用户名和密码

嘿,小哥哥小姐姐们,想要在MySQL数据库里探探用户权限的奥秘?别急,我来教你们怎么查看用户名和权限信息,但要注意哦,密码可是加密的,咱们看不到原版哦!
首先,得登录数据库。
简单几步:在终端里敲下 mysql -u root -p,然后输入root用户的密码。
登录成功后,就可以使用 use mysql; select from user; 命令来查看所有用户的信息了。
不过,密码这部分是加密的,咱们只能看看其他信息。

如果你想查看某个特定用户的信息,那就用 select from user where user='用户名';,这样就能找到那个用户的具体信息啦,密码依旧保密。

在MySQL里,用户的权限信息都藏在 mysql.user 这个表里,里面有你想要的用户名、主机名,还有密码哈希值。
但放心,哈希是加密过的,咱们看不懂。

如果你想给用户换密码,那可就简单了,用 alter user '用户名'@'主机名' identified by '新密码'; 这句SQL语句,新密码就会生效。

操作数据库的时候,一定要确保你有权限哦,没权限就去找数据库管理员帮忙吧。
还有啊,为了安全,定期给数据库用户换个强密码是个好习惯。

操作过程中要小心,别一不小心就误操作了,别让数据说拜拜啊。
希望我的小技巧能帮到你们,祝大家操作愉快!🎉

怎么查看mysql密码

要是你在安装 MySQL 的时候没给 root 用户设置密码,那直接用 root 登录就行,用户名是 root,密码留空。
但如果密码设过之后给忘了,那没办法,MySQL 的密码是动态加密的,而且是 MD5 的,这加密方式是不可逆的,所以你只能找回用户名,密码是查不到的。
想知道用户名的话,可以执行这个 SQL 命令:select from mysql.user;

怎样找到mysql的用户名和密码

哈,你们知道不?安装MySQL时要是没设置用户名和密码,那登录就简单了,直接用root身份,用户名“root”,密码空空如也。
但问题来了,万一哪天你改了密码又给忘了,这可怎么办呢?哎,由于MySQL密码是动态MD5 加密的,也就是说加密过程是单方向的,所以密码一旦加密就无法解密,这就意味着我们根本无法通过查询找回密码。
不过别急,这时候你唯一能掌握的就是用户名了。
怎么查呢?简单,用一条SQL语句就行:select from mysql.user; 这会把你数据库里的所有用户信息都给你列出来,用户名自然也包括在内,这样你就知道是自己哪个账号了。
记得啊,操作的时候可要谨慎,毕竟安全才是王道嘛!

mysql密码忘记了怎么办

嘿,小老弟!想轻松进入MySQL数据库?先得找到并修改那个my.cnf配置文件。
如果是root身份,直接用vim编辑器打开它,普通用户就先用sudo再打开。
找到[mysqld]那一节,然后在后面加上一行“skip-grant-tables”来跳过密码验证。
编辑完,按ESC退出,然后输入:wq保存并退出编辑器。
接下来,重启mysqld服务,然后就可以不输入密码直接进入MySQL啦!不过,别慌,那些“Entering password”的提示不用管,直接回车就OK了。

进到MySQL后,想改root密码?没问题,直接在“mysql”数据库的“user”表中更新root用户的密码记录。
想知道用户名和密码?如果安装时没设置,就用root用户名,密码留空。
进去后执行“select from MySQL.user;”就能看到用户信息了,密码都是加密的。
所以,如果设置了密码又忘了,抱歉,只能看到用户名,密码是MD5 加密的,不能逆向查询。
所以啊,记得你设置的密码,或者干脆别设置密码。